# 在Docker环境中安装Qt:一步一步的指南
Qt是一个跨平台的应用程序开发框架,广泛用于开发GUI应用程序。随着Docker技术的快速发展,越来越多的开发者选择在Docker环境中构建和部署Qt应用。本文将带您一步一步了解如何在Docker中安装Qt,并提供必要的代码示例和图解。
## Docker简介
Docker是一种轻量级的虚拟化技术,它允许在隔离的环境中运行软件。通过使用Doc
本文介绍了如何实现一个可最大化、最小化的QDockWidget,既然客户要求了,那么就去实现吧。
1 需求描述由于项目需要,xx软件的一些模块均是以dockwidget的方式进行开发的,这样便于实现灵活布局;但是在某些情况下需要全屏展示dockwidget中的内容,遗憾的是QDockWidget除了关闭按钮,最小化、最大化按钮都没提供。简单整理下需求:在
转载
2023-11-03 18:16:22
153阅读
# 在Docker中使用Qt的指南
随着容器化技术的迅速发展,Docker已经成为开发、部署和运行应用程序的标准工具。而Qt,则是一个广泛使用的跨平台C++应用框架,为开发图形用户界面(GUI)和应用程序提供了强大的工具和库。将Qt与Docker结合使用,可以高效地进行应用程序的打包和分发。本文将介绍如何在Docker容器中设置和运行Qt应用程序,并提供具体的代码示例。
## 1. 什么是Do
原创
2024-08-04 07:51:46
182阅读
# 在Docker中配置Qt环境的完整指南
随着容器技术的发展,使用Docker来部署和开发Qt应用程序越来越流行。对于刚入行的小白来说,理解如何在Docker内配置Qt环境可能会有些困难。本文将逐步指导你完成这一过程,包含所需代码以及详细的注释说明。
## 整体流程
在开始之前,我们可以将整个配置流程分解成如下几个步骤:
| 步骤 | 描述
Telnet 安装teInet 检查是否安装有telnet,键入:rpm -qa | grep telnet 回车返回空值则说明没有安装,返回telnet版本号则说明已经安装;安装teInetyum -y install telnet* # 安装telnet客户端和服务端;开启服务telnet服务安装之后,默认是不开启服务,修改文件/etc/xinetd.d/telnet来开启服务。如下图,在xi
转载
2023-07-17 11:38:16
78阅读
目录【Docker + qemu】1. 安装docker2. 运行docker【unsuccess版 】手动搭建1. 下载linux kernel2. 安装qemu3. 安装交叉工具链4. 编译内核5. 用qemu启动尝试6. 制作根文件系统下载、编译和安装busybox形成根目录结构制作根文件系统镜像7. 系统启动运行所有内容均来自互联网,记录了些自己调试的过程【Docker + qe
转载
2024-02-04 21:28:30
187阅读
1、下载NETCore SDK,下载后文件拷贝到root文件夹下下载 .NET Core 3.1 SDK (v3.1.403) - Linux x64 Binaries2、创建目录mkdir -p /usr/local/dotnet3、解压tar zxf dotnet-sdk-3.1.403-linux-x64.tar.gz -C /usr/local/dotnet4、winSP进去编辑 /etc
转载
2023-07-17 11:38:31
82阅读
鸣谢:Error response from daemon: Failed to Setup IP tables: Unable to enable SKIP DNAT rule:
(iptables failed: iptables --wait -t nat -I DOCKER -i br-39ac611a0749 -j RETURN: iptables: No chain/target/
转载
2023-07-17 11:38:43
88阅读
注:确认你已经安装了docker, docker案子网上有很多教程,我也有写, 一搜一大堆,所以这里就不累赘来讲述。在docker下去安装, 我使用的是 docker镜像列表中oracle11g — version: 11.2.0.2 ,镜像名为 jaspeen/oracle-xe-11g ,一直在使用,很稳定,所以推荐。安装步骤:1、直接拉取镜像:docker pull jaspeen/orac
转载
2023-09-27 10:08:18
88阅读
官网介绍:https://wiki.qt.io/Install_Qt_5_on_Ubuntu
Contents
[hide]
1Install Qt 5 on Ubuntu
1.1Introduction
1.2Installation Guide
1.3Troubleshooting
1.4References
Install Qt 5 on Ubuntu
Introduction
转载
2018-10-30 14:26:00
491阅读
docker安装docker产品文档在虚拟机上安装docker基础设置默认你已经具有了云计算hcia水准能正确操作和创建虚拟机虚拟机使用nat网络模式,通过ssh链接xftp或者其他类似应用查看内核版本uname -r比如我的:3.10.0-327.e17.x86_64关闭防火墙systemctl stop firewalld
systemctl disable firewalld
setenfo
转载
2024-06-27 21:23:20
45阅读
文章目录docker 安装oracle11g一、安装docker 容器二、进入docker 容器三、删除容器四、navciat连接oracle数据库五、修改字符集1、配置oracle字符集2、修改Oracle字符集为ZHS16GBK六、导入数据库1、将数据文件上传到服务器的/data/oracle/目录中然后导入2、如果提示ORA-39002错误,表示oracle账户没有/data/oracle
转载
2023-09-23 17:04:17
142阅读
1.部署单点es1.1.创建网络因为我们还需要部署kibana容器,因此需要让es和kibana容器互联。这里先创建一个网络:# 创建一个网络:es-net
docker network create es-net
# 查看本机的网络
docker network ls
# 删除一个网络:es-net
docker network rm es-net1.2.加载elasticsearch 和
转载
2023-07-17 11:38:58
96阅读
什么是 DockerDocker 是一个开源项目,诞生于 2013 年初,最初是 dotCloud 公司内部的一个业余项目。它基于 Google公司推出的 Go 语言实现。 项目后来加入了 Linux 基金会,遵从了 Apache 2.0 协议,项目代码在 GitHub上进行维护。Docker 自开源后受到广泛的关注和讨论,以至于 dotCloud 公司后来都改名为 Docker Inc。Redh
文章目录0.前言1.qbittorrent是什么?2.在UnRaid中安装部署设置qbittorrent2.1.关于qbittorrent的安装2.2.关于qbittorrent的配置3.All Done! 0.前言之前已经写过关于UnRaid的系列文章,今天就下载软件qbittorrent在UnRaid中的安装配置和常见的一些坑的解决方案作如下分享:1.qbittorrent是什么?qBitt
转载
2023-07-14 22:29:10
513阅读
CentOS7安装Docker一、安装docker1.检查内核版本 Docker要求Linux系统的内核版本高与3.10,所以安装前通过命令检查内核版本, 命令如下uname -r2.更新系统软件 更新系统依赖包,以便于Docker的安装sudo yum update3.卸载旧版本docker 卸载掉旧版本,以免与新版本冲突sudo yum remove docker docker-common
转载
2023-09-03 13:44:12
197阅读
一、使用背景想在windows系统下用docker环境,但是又懒得装Vmware和linux系统。正好Docker官方也支持Windows版Docker桌面,本次就在Win10上安装Docker Desktop[跳舞]。二、采用Hyper-v +容器方式安装2.1.1 官方要求Docker Desktop环境请先阅读以下链接文档内容: Windows10安装docker中文版https://doc
转载
2023-08-18 16:19:29
202阅读
Docker安装# 清理:
sudo apt-get remove -y docker docker-engine docker.io
# 安装依赖:
sudo apt-get install -y apt-transport-https ca-certificates curl gnupg2 software-properties-common
# 信任 Docker 的 GPG 公钥:
c
转载
2024-06-04 20:48:08
94阅读
如果安装了 Docker Desktop,则已经安装了完整的 Docker,包括 Compose。一、在 Ubuntu 上安装 Docker Desktop
DEB 包先决条件要成功安装 Docker Desktop,您必须:满足系统要求
拥有 Ubuntu Jammy Jellyfish 22.04 (LTS) 或 Ubuntu Impish Indri 21.10 的 64 位版本。
转载
2023-08-30 17:06:49
171阅读
我试图将我的Linux机器设置为运行多个来宾OS,其中一个是Windows VM,另一个是Linux容器。这里的目标是防止我弄乱主机系统,同时可以自由操作基本操作系统并使用主机硬件。最终,我希望在容器中运行我的桌面,然后希望运行图形加速的模拟等。由于Docker具有如此好的git内置容器版本,因此使用它似乎是一个好主意。也许libvirt与LXC一样好,但是docker的特权模式使不必为容器配置设
转载
2023-07-28 11:51:39
230阅读